dc.description.abstractA significant part of this industry is the operation of warehouses. Layout design is one important factor that has a bearing on the effectiveness of warehouse operations. In this study, the layout of the warehouses where different suppliers gather and store products for a specified period then deliver to various customers will be examined with regard to aisle design and shelf configuration. In the distribution centre, piece and pack picking are mainly carried out. The study aims at designing a storage configuration that minimises the yearly total handling costs after rearrangement products into racks. For the placement or pick of products from the storage area in relation to the distances between the shelves and docks, account shall be taken of ordering frequency and weight. A particle swarm optimization algorithm is proposed as a novel heuristic approach to find the optimal solution.
